Three equal resistors connected in series across a source of emf together dissipate 10W of power. What should be the power dissipated if the same resistors are connected in parallel across the same source of emf?

Solution

The correct option is B 90W
Case 1:- (When connected in series)
Rnet=R+R+R=3R
Power dissipated$=\cfrac{V^{2}}{R_{net}}=\cfrac{V^{2}}{3R}=10W
V2R=30W

Case 2:-(When connected in parallel)
Rnet=R3
Power dissipated=V2Rnet(Case2)=3(V2R)
=3×30W=90W
